Main local history museum covering salt production, spa culture, and urban development. Best starting point for understanding Bad Salzuflen.
Compact museum area interpreting the city’s historic saltmaking tradition. Worth seeing for the industry that shaped the town’s identity.
Small museum presentation in nearby Schötmar focused on local cultural memory and district history. A rewarding stop for regional enthusiasts.
Historic old town with lanes, half-timbered houses, and spa-town charm. The essential area for strolling, photography, and atmosphere.
Large landscaped spa park with lawns, flowers, and saline air nearby. Ideal for relaxing walks and a classic Bad Salzuflen experience.
Tree-lined promenade near the spa facilities and graduation works. A pleasant walking route central to the town’s therapeutic resort atmosphere.
Hearty Westphalian rye bread baked dark and dense. It is a regional staple, traditionally served with ham, cheese, or butter in Lippe and wider Westphalia.
A robust plate of blood sausage, liver sausage, and pork belly, often served with pickles and bread. It is a classic rural specialty of Westphalia.
Smoked Westphalian ham cured and air-dried for a deep savory flavor. It is one of the best-known regional foods and often served thinly sliced on bread.

Moderate for Germany. Hotels and spa stays can raise costs, but casual dining and local transit are fairly reasonable for visitors.
Tipping is customary but modest. Round up or add about 5-10% in restaurants, round up for taxis, and leave small change in cafes.
